Misfiring under load/low rpm, New coils/plugs/injectors

My 2008 has been doing this for almost 10years now but its so consistent that i'd like to actually fix it at some point. At low rpm when lugging the engine or basically cruising in O/D at any time or in any gear it will thump in the floorboard which is most certainly a misfire. The great thing is it never throws codes for it. Years ago i replaced the plugs around 100k which cured the heavy symptoms. Then at some point around 150-175 i replaced all 6 coils/plugs. Around 190k it actually threw a misfire code for a bad injector which i changed. At 195k i had all injectors replaced when i had my water pump job done as PM. Car has also had the OSS/TSS sensors done in the transmission. Basically at 218k this vehicle has had all of the items done that should cause this problem and still misfires religiously with no codes. Does the PCM itself actually control spark to the point where it would be the last item to change? I have never "fried" a coil that would have damaged it and the problem has continued throughout the last 120k miles of this thing's life despite all these parts being changed.
